Desperado (film)

Desperado is a film made in 1995 directed by Robert Rodriguez. The film stars Antonio Banderas and Salma Hayek. It is the sequel to El Mariachi.

Banderas plays El Mariachi, a former guitarist who seeks revenge on the man who killed the woman he loved. His quest leads him to battle with a drug lord. He also falls in love with Carolina (played by Hayek), a woman who works for the drug lord.

Desperado helped enhance the fame of Antonio Banderas and introduced Salma Hayek to the American audiences. In 2003, a sequel of Desperado, Once Upon a Time in Mexico, was released.

Salma Hayek's role in the film is the first starring role for a Mexican actress in a Hollywood film since Dolores del Rio in the 1940s. The studio initially wanted a blonde to play the role; after a screen test Hayek was the clear choice for the character.

Technical data

  • working titles: El Mariachi 2, Pistolero
  • writing credits: Robert Rodriguez
  • music: Tito Larriva , Los Lobos
  • runtime: 106 minutes
  • sound: Dolby SR / SDDS
  • aspect ratio: 1.85 : 1
  • release dates: May 1995 (Cannes Film Festival, France, premiere), August 25, 1995 (USA)
  • budget: $7,000,000
  • total gross (USA): $25,625,110
  • distibutor: Columbia Pictures
  • MPAA rating: R
